Bird Neglect Is Short-Sighted.

The destruction of the quail is costing the wheat growers of the entire United States $100,000,000 a year—chinch bugs. Potato growers of the United States are paying out 000 a year for paris green to protect their potatoes from the potato bug. The quail, natural enemy of the bug, has been almost exterminated.
